Welcome to Flowood, MS

Currently one of the fastest growing towns in Mississippi is Flowood - east of the Jackson city limits. Flowood has gained in popularity in the last few years due to its great location. The growth and welfare of this town is strongly supported by its highly rated Police and Fire Departments. Excellent neighborhoods and a wide variety of corporate and retail businesses give this town a good tax base. Flowood is part of Rankin County.

Flowood has seven top-rated city schools and the state-of-the-art Flowood Library. Six institutions of higher learning, two private schools, Woman's Hospital, River Oaks Hospital, the Jackson International Airport, and the University of Mississippi Medical School and the Veterans Hospital in Jackson exist within 12 miles of Flowood. In the last three years some of the top retail stores and restaurants have relocated to Flowood and are located in these shopping areas: Dogwood Promenade, Lakeland Commons and Market Street, and Dogwood Festival.

A wide variety of recreational accommodations are found in Flowood - Crystal Lake, located on Flowood Drive offers fishing and boating with handicapped piers and events such as the Kid's Fishing Rodeo held annually, Flowood Liberty Park has a 40-acre facility with a premier baseball field complex as well as a four-plex softball field plus four Olympic-size soccer fields.
